Finding duplicate values in an Excel spreadsheet is a common task that can be accomplished in several ways, depending on the version of Excel you are using and the size and complexity of your dataset. Here are a few common methods for checking duplicates in Excel:

Conditional Formatting: This method allows you to visually identify duplicate values by applying a specific format to them. Select the range of cells you want to check for duplicates, go to the “Home” tab, and click on “Conditional Formatting” > “Highlight Cell Rules” > “Duplicate Values.” You can choose to highlight duplicates with a specific color, font, or border.

Remove Duplicates: This tool allows you to quickly remove duplicate values from your dataset. Select the range of cells you want to check for duplicates, go to the “Data” tab, and click on “Remove Duplicates.” Excel will remove all duplicate values, leaving only unique values in your dataset.

COUNTIF Function: This function allows you to count the number of times a specific value appears in a range of cells. To check for duplicates, you can use the COUNTIF function to count the number of times a value appears in a range. If the count is greater than 1, then the value is a duplicate.

INDEX and MATCH Functions: These functions can be used together to find the first instance of a duplicate value in a range of cells. The INDEX function returns the value of a cell at a specified row and column, while the MATCH function finds the position of a value in a range. By combining these functions, you can identify the first instance of a duplicate value and then use other functions to manipulate or remove the duplicate values as needed.

2. Remove the duplicate values

Removing duplicate values is an essential part of checking for duplicates in Excel. Once you have identified the duplicate values, you can remove them to ensure that your data is accurate and reliable. There are three main ways to remove duplicate values in Excel:

  • Manually: You can manually remove duplicate values by selecting them and pressing the Delete key. This is the most basic method of removing duplicate values, but it can be time-consuming if you have a large dataset.
  • Using the Remove Duplicates tool: The Remove Duplicates tool is a built-in Excel tool that allows you to quickly and easily remove duplicate values. To use the Remove Duplicates tool, select the range of cells that you want to check for duplicates, and then click the “Data” tab. In the “Data Tools” group, click the “Remove Duplicates” button. The Remove Duplicates tool will remove all duplicate values from the selected range.
  • Using a formula: You can also use a formula to remove duplicate values. The most common formula for removing duplicate values is the UNIQUE function. The UNIQUE function returns a list of unique values from a range of cells. To use the UNIQUE function, enter the following formula into a blank cell:

    =UNIQUE(range)

    where “range” is the range of cells that you want to check for duplicates. The UNIQUE function will return a list of unique values from the specified range.

Question 4: How can I prevent duplicate values from being entered into a dataset?

Answer: To prevent duplicate values from being entered into a dataset, you can use data validation. To do this, select the range of cells that you want to prevent duplicates from being entered into, and then go to the Data tab and click on the Data Validation button. In the Data Validation dialog box, select the “Custom” validation rule and then enter the following formula into the Formula field: =COUNTIF($A:$A, A1)=1. This formula will prevent any duplicate values from being entered into the selected range of cells.

Tip 6: Sort Data Before Checking for Duplicates

Sorting the data in ascending or descending order can group duplicate values together, making them easier to identify and manage.

Tip 7: Use the Advanced Filter Option for Complex Scenarios

For more complex scenarios, utilize the Advanced Filter option. This tool allows you to filter and extract unique values based on multiple criteria, providing greater flexibility in duplicate value management.
